  5. I acquired a 130pds in a deal which unfortunately had too much chopped off I fixed it by supergluing 6mm of tube to the end of drawtube and fitting a grub screw to the flat surface on draw tube slightly in front of the stop to act as a new stop so drawtube can’t fall off support rollers .

  7. Wind out draw tube until it hits stop now look in ota the protruding tube is the max to cut off it’s only about 10mm to much and tube will run on rollers supporting drawtube before it hits drawtube stop .
  8. I you dither 10-12 pixels then Darks not required just bias and flats ,bias you can do every now and again three or four times of year and flats on the night,time saver .
